[Patch 8/8] /proc export of aggregated block I/O delays

From: Shailabh Nagar
Date: Sat Apr 22 2006 - 17:15:05 EST


Changelog
Fixed comments by akpm
- use __u64 for delayacct_blkio_ticks() return type
- redundant check for tsk->delays in __delayacct_blkio_ticks()


delayacct-procfs.patch

Export I/O delays seen by a task through /proc/<tgid>/stats
for use in top etc.

Note that delays for I/O done for swapping in pages (swapin I/O) is
clubbed together with all other I/O here (this is not the
case in the netlink interface where the swapin I/O is kept distinct)
